Cyprus March Trade Shortfall Narrows

Cyprus' merchandise trade deficit decreased in March, data released by the statistical office showed Friday.

The trade deficit dropped to EUR 252.13 million in March from EUR 286.91 million in February. In March 2012, the balance was a deficit of EUR 398.66 million.

The value of exports was EUR 116.6 million in March, of which EUR 62.6 million were dispatches to other member states of the European Union, and EUR 54 million were shipped to third countries.

The value of total imports was EUR 368.8 million, of which EUR 276.2 million were from EU member countries, and EUR 92.6 million from countries outside the EU, data showed.
